I got a PHD for the 790, then found that the 3PH wouldn't go high enough to get it off the ground. I ordered another adjustable link to replace the fixed "down link" on the left side of the 3PH, to get it higher. I realize I will have to drill the hole, then, with the auger down, adjust out the links to get to the right depth. Anyone else have this situation?? /forums/images/graemlins/tongue.gif

I got it fixed, and working by drilling holes in the down link forks from the lift arms 1.5 inches up from original. Works great now.
